What is behind the Korean beauty trend Double Cleansing?
There is probably no beauty trend from Korea that we haven’t tried out yet. There are certain tips that have made it directly into our daily skincare routine: This is also the case with a hype called double-cleansing. With this type of cleansing, as the name suggests, the face is cleaned twice. In two steps.
This method is intended to cleanse the face down to the pores, remove make-up and dirt and leave the skin feeling fresh. In the long term, the complexion can also change positively.
How does the “double cleaning” work?
Step 1: Baba make-up, sebum & Co
Gentle cleansing oil or balm is best for the first step. The oil-based cleanser gently removes excess sebum, make-up, and dirt from the skin. This is because these residues are oil-based – and oil is dissolved by oil. Cleansing oils are particularly gentle on the skin and hardly remove any moisture. In this first step of cleansing, we first only clean the surface of the skin and prepare the face for the actual cleansing.

Step 2: clean the skin
This is followed in the second step by cleaning the face with a water-based cleanser – e.g. B. with a classic washing gel. This second step removes all dirt that has accumulated on our skin over the day and cleanses thoroughly. These include sweat, dust particles, or dead skin cells. Dry skin types should use a cream cleanser for this step, while micellar water is perfect for cleansing the face for normal and combination skin. When is Double Cleansing used?
It is best to use this cleaning tip once a day in the evening before going to bed. In general, double cleansing should only be done once a day. In the morning, all you have to do is wash your face with water. Anything above that can irritate the skin, causing it to produce more oil and sebum. That is why it also counts here: less is more!
And best of all: this care trend is suitable for every skin type. It is only important that you only use gels and oils that are tailored to your skin type. Especially if you use makeup regularly, your skin will be happy with the new routine.
